加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0722zz.cn/)- 数据可视化、数据开发、智能机器人、智能内容、图像分析!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L事务控制在H5开发中的实战应用

发布时间:2026-04-22 11:38:19 所属栏目:MySql教程 来源:DaWei
导读:  在H5开发中,尤其是在涉及用户交互和数据操作的场景下,MySQL事务控制显得尤为重要。事务能够确保数据库操作的完整性与一致性,避免因网络问题或系统错误导致的数据不一致。  当用户进行如下单、支付等关键操作

  在H5开发中,尤其是在涉及用户交互和数据操作的场景下,MySQL事务控制显得尤为重要。事务能够确保数据库操作的完整性与一致性,避免因网络问题或系统错误导致的数据不一致。


  当用户进行如下单、支付等关键操作时,通常需要执行多个数据库操作,例如更新订单状态、减少库存、记录日志等。如果其中任何一个操作失败,事务可以回滚所有已执行的操作,从而保持数据的一致性。


  在H5应用中,可以通过后端接口来实现事务控制。前端发送请求到后端,后端接收到请求后开启事务,执行一系列数据库操作,若全部成功则提交事务,否则回滚。这样可以有效防止部分操作成功而其他操作失败的情况。


AI绘图结果,仅供参考

  为了提高系统的稳定性,建议在事务处理过程中加入异常捕获机制。一旦发生错误,及时回滚事务并返回错误信息,避免脏数据的产生。同时,合理设置事务的隔离级别,可以减少并发操作带来的问题。


  在高并发场景下,事务的使用需要谨慎。长时间持有事务可能导致锁竞争,影响系统性能。因此,应尽量缩短事务的执行时间,并合理设计数据库表结构,以提升事务处理效率。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章